A pair of Baroque white and parcel gilt console tables South Germany, Franconia, possibly Bamberg or Würzburg, early 18th century

Description

  • oak, fruitwood
  • 76cm. high, 93,5cm. wide, 51,5cm. deep.; 2ft. 6in., 3ft ¾ in., 1ft. 8¼in.
each with a mottled pink and white marble top, above a bolection frieze with half scalloped shells to centre and corners above lambrequin, on square tapering column legs on inward scrolled feet joined by a shaped stretcher joining at central plateau, on a white ground with gilt raised scrolling decoration

Condition

These attractive tables are in very good conserved condition. The white ground has been redecorated. Re-gilt, displaying an attractive craquelure throughout. There are small losses to gilding and minor re-touching. Tops with age but not original.
